Study Details

This is a single-institution, open-label, early-phase study to assess the ability of ribociclib (LEE011) to inhibit CDK4/CDK6/Rb/E2F signaling and cell proliferation/viability in core and infiltrating tumor tissues obtained from patients with recurrent glioblastoma or anaplastic glioma compared to the baseline/primary pathologic tumor specimen. Abundant preclinical evidence indicates that Rb-deficient cancer cells are resistant to CDK4/6 inhibition and ongoing trials with CDK4/6 inhibitors exclude patients with Rb-deficient tumors. The investigators will evaluate 10 patients with Rb-positive glioblastoma or anaplastic glioma in this study. Given that a minority of glioblastomas ha Rb loss the investigators anticipate enrolling a maximum of 20 patients, to meet our goal of 10 patients with Rb-positive tumors.

Arms

  • Experimental: Ribociclib (LEE011) Treatment
    Patients will be treated with ribociclib (LEE011) (recommended phase 2 dose of 600 mg/day) for 8-21 days prior to surgery. For preliminary evaluation of efficacy and toxicity, patients with Rb-positive tumors will resume treatment with ribociclib at 14-28 days post-surgery on a schedule of 21 days on, 7 days off in a 28-day cycle. Patients will be treated until unacceptable toxicity is observed, or until disease progression as assessed by radiographic or clinical metrics.
